Sternglas Naos Pro GMT Automatik

Owners report the Sternglas Naos can feel underwhelming with a cheap feel and hands resembling office printer output, with some finding it wears smaller than expected and looks like a toy, though others appreciate its understated design. Reviewers highlight the Argo Automatic variant as a compelling sub-€400 mechanical watch with a colorful dial and practical date wheel, suitable for new collectors, featuring a 38mm case and a Miyota 8215 movement. On balance, the consensus is that the Sternglas Naos offers a mixed ownership experience, with its value proposition and entry-level appeal being its strongest points for some.

From video reviewers

The Sternglas Naos Pro GMT Automatik features a clean Bauhaus design that sets it apart from other GMT watches. A notable weakness is the watch's bezel action, which is not as smooth as some reviewers would have liked. Reviewers disagree on the watch's case size, with one reviewer stating it's slightly larger than the original Naos Automatic, while another reviewer doesn't mention this aspect at all.

Yema Navygraf Pearl CMM.20

The Yema Navygraf Pearl CMM.20 is praised for its elegant and slim case design, measuring between 9.5mm and 9.75mm thick, and its unique mother-of-pearl dial and bezel. The watch features functional dive watch elements like 200-meter water resistance and is powered by the in-house CMM.20 micro-rotor movement, which offers a 70-hour power reserve and is adjusted to -3/+7 seconds a day. Overall, reviewers highlight the Yema Navygraf Pearl CMM.20's sophisticated aesthetic and slim profile as its primary strengths.
